Biography of Selena Quintanilla

Selena Quintanilla was born on April 16, 1971, in Lake Jackson, Texas. She was the youngest of three siblings and displayed a passion for music from an early age. Her father, Abraham Quintanilla Jr., recognized her talent and encouraged her to pursue a career in music.

Early Life and Career Beginnings

Selena began her career by performing in her family's band, Selena y Los Dinos, which was formed in 1980. The band started gaining popularity in the Tejano music scene in the late 1980s. Despite facing considerable challenges as a female artist in a male-dominated genre, Selena's charisma and talent quickly set her apart.

Challenges Faced

  • Gender Discrimination: Selena faced challenges as a woman in the Tejano music industry, where male artists predominated.
  • Language Barrier: Initially, she performed primarily in Spanish, which posed a challenge as she sought to reach a broader audience.
  • Financial Struggles: Early on, her family faced financial difficulties, which made it challenging to promote her music.

Rise to Fame

Selena's breakthrough came with the release of her album "Ven Conmigo" in 1990, which included hits like "Como La Flor." Her unique sound and style resonated with audiences, propelling her to stardom. She became the first female Tejano artist to win a Grammy Award, solidifying her status as a music icon.

Symbolism of the White Rose

The white rose symbolizes purity, love, and remembrance. After Selena's tragic passing in 1995, fans began associating the white rose with her memory. It became a symbol of hope and resilience for her followers, representing the enduring spirit of her music and legacy.

Why the White Rose?

  • Purity: The white rose represents the purity of Selena's intentions and her love for music.
  • Remembrance: Fans often leave white roses at her memorial, symbolizing their everlasting love for her.
  • Hope: The white rose serves as a reminder of the hope she brought to countless lives through her music.
